GL-18H/18HL type GX-F/H E GXL F GL GX-M GX-U/GX-FU/ GX-N GX GL-18H type GL-18HL type Sensing range • The sensing range is specified for the standard sensing object. With a non-ferrous metal, the sensing range is obtained by multiplying with the correction coefficient specified below. Further, the sensing range also changes if the sensing object is smaller than the standard sensing object or if the sensing object is plated. Correction coefficient GL-18H type GL-18HL type Iron 1 1 Stainless steel (SUS304) 0.68 approx. 0.65 approx. Brass 0.45 approx. 0.42 approx. Aluminum 0.43 approx. 0.41 approx. GL-18H type: 11 mm 0.433 in • Please carry out the wiring carefully since protection circuit against reverse power supply connection is not incorporated. • The output does not incorporate a short-circuit protection circuit. Do not connect it directly to a power supply or a capacitive load. • Make sure that the power supply is off while wiring. • Verify that the supply voltage variation is within the rating. • If power is supplied from a commercial switching regulator, ensure that the frame ground (F.G.) terminal of the power supply is connected to an actual ground. • In case noise generating equipment (switching regulator, inverter motor, etc.) is used in the vicinity of this sensor, connect the frame ground (F.G.) terminal of the equipment to an actual ground. • Do not run the wires together with high-voltage lines or power lines or put them in the same raceway. This can cause malfunction due to induction. Others • Do not use during the initial transient time (50ms) after the power supply is switched on. • Take care that the sensor does not come in direct contact with oil, grease, or organic solvents, such as, thinner, etc. • Make sure that the sensing end is not covered with metal dust, scrap or spatter. It will result in malfunction.
